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    Crea link su ListView su sviluppo android

    Ciao ho creato una ListView in java da visualizzare sulla mia nuova app. Prima di girare i l codice potete darmi supporto in tal senso.

    grazie
    seb

  2. #2
    Di seguito il mio codice:

    All'interno del metodo OnCreate

    String[] accessori = { "Wind.it", "Digital Store Wind", "Play Store", "eBay", "Amazon", "Samsung Store", "Apple Store", "Windows Store", "Disney Store"};

    ArrayAdapter<String> adapter=new ArrayAdapter<String>(this,android.R.layout.simple_ list_item_1,accessori);
    ListView lv= (ListView) findViewById(R.id.elencoaccessori);
    lv.setAdapter(adapter);

    lv.setOnItemClickListener(new AdapterView.OnItemClickListener() {
    @Override
    public void onItemClick(AdapterView<?> adattatore, final View componente, int pos, long id) {

    //recupero il titolo memorizzato nella riga tramite l'ArrayAdapter
    final String titolo = (String) adattatore.getItemAtPosition(pos);

    //al click compare il testo del titolo della riga per qualche secondo
    Toast.makeText(getApplicationContext(), titolo, Toast.LENGTH_SHORT).show();

  3. #3
    Fino a qui tutto ok, funziona tutto
    Adesso vorrei inserire su ogni riga visualizzata un link di collegamento ad un'altra MainActivity.
    Dopo il Toast ho inserite il seguente codice:

    Intent visit_wind = new Intent(MainActivity_3_canali.this, MainActivity_wind.class);
    startActivity(visit_wind);

    Ma ho notato che in questo modo tutte le righe della mia ListView mi portano sulla MainActivity_wind.
    Come posso indirizzare ogni singola riga della LisView alla sua MainActivity specifica???

    Spero sia stato chiaro, grazie a presto.
    Seb

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.